Abstract

The aim of t h i s report was to determine the e f f e c t of column widths in W-section to HSS c o n n e c t i o n s and whether r e i n f o r c i n g of the column wall would i n c r e a s e the s t r e n g th and r i g i d i t y of the j o i n t . Lab t e s t i n g on such c o n n e c t i o ns i n d i c a t e t h a t HSS width do not have an e f f e c t on the s t r e n g th of the c o n n e c t i o n but with i n c r e a s i n g width the f l e x i b i l i t y i n c r e a s e s . Tests a l s o show t h a t as much as 30% i n c r e a s e in s t r e n g t h can be obtained i n t h e s e c o n n e c t i o n s by r e i n f o r c e m e nt of the column w a l l s by w e l d i n g a p l a t e to the HSS where the beam w i l l be framing i n t o i t .
